Book Description: The past decade has witnessed the remarkable development of new, highly effective approaches for the treatment of advanced prostate cancer - new hormonal agents, cytotoxic chemotherapeutic drugs, targeted therapeutics and immunotherapy. This book thoroughly reviews the current state of systemic therapy for prostate cancer, including agents approved or undergoing investigation, building on the intensive research of the past three decades that has elucidated the specific molecular mechanisms by which the prostate cancer cell achieves castration resistance. This timely collection of chapters from internationally recognized experts covers all the significant advances in the field. The emphasis in each chapter is on the mechanism of action of the agents, and the authors take pains to describe precisely their response rates, impact on survival and adverse effects.
